🤔💭Will the accused be able to apply for bail? Will we hear from new witnesses? The SenzoMeyiwa trail will start from scratch on Tuesday even though it had been going on for a year⚽ TheCitizenNews Read more⬇️

During Monday’s court proceedings, judge Mokgoatlheng said the accused will be given an opportunity to apply for bail now that the trial will be restarting from the beginning. However, the bail hearing will have to be heard by a different judge.

Their lawyers also received an indictment and charge sheet from the state, which means that the accused will have to re-plea again by stating whether they are guilty or not guilty to the charges against them in connection with Meyiwa’s murder on 26 October 2014.
